How to align the leave year with an employee's start date
Some companies choose to begin the annual leave year on the date that the employee starts at the company. The benefits of this are that there are no difficult calculations when it comes to accruals, and it can avoid the situation where all your employees are trying to use up their remaining allowances at the same time of year.
In Leave Dates, it is possible for employees to use a different start date for their leave year compared to the standard company leave year.
Setting up employee leave years
Here are the steps to configure an employee with a leave year which starts on a different date to the company leave year:
- Check that the company is set up with an annual leave year starting on the 1st January. Check this in the Settings > Calendars page.
- Go to the Settings > Employees page and click on the employee you want to set up.
- In the Employment details tab, enter the employee start date

- Proceed to the Allowance tab. Here you find an indication of whether the employee is on the regular company’s year. If so, click on the Change link

- A prompt as shown below will appear for leave year start date with three options:
- Company start date
- Employment start date
- Customize start date

- Click on Employment start date and the on Save changes

Click again Save changes
That's it!
In the My Year page, the new leave year will be shown for this employee.

Notes
- Admin users still need to create new calendars for each year. These will then create the leave allowance years for employees using this functionality. For example, if the calendar runs from 1st Jan 2026 to 31st December 2026 and your employment start date is 10th March 2026, then your first allowance period will be 10th March 2026 — 9th March 2027. To create a second allowance period for 10th March 2027 — 9th March 2028, just add a new calendar.
- You also still need to configure your leave allowances using the normal process.
